ຕົວ​ສ້າງ​ການ​ທົດສອບ

ການນໍາໃຊ້ການຄ້າ OK 380+ ແບບ ບໍ່ມີ​ເຄື່ອງ​ໝາຍ​ນ້ຳ ບໍ່ມີ​ການ​ລົງທະບຽນ​ທີ່​ຕ້ອງການ
ແບບ:
+ GPT-5, Claude, Gemini
ຕິດໂຄດ (ຫຼືອັບໂຫລດໄຟລ໌) ແລະໄດ້ຮັບຊຸດທົດສອບເຕັມສໍາລັບກອບຂອງທາງເລືອກຂອງທ່ານ - pytest, unittest, Jest, Mocha, Vitest, JUnit, ໄປທົດສອບ, RSpec, PHPUnit, ຫຼື XCTest. ເລືອກເປົ້າຫມາຍການປົກຄຸມ (ເສັ້ນທາງທີ່ສະຫງົບສຸກ / ກໍລະນີ Edge / ກໍລະນີຂໍ້ຜິດພາດ / ມູນຄ່າທີ່ອີງໃສ່) ເພື່ອນໍາພາຄວາມສໍາຄັນ. ຟຣີພາຍໃຕ້ pool ທຸກໆມື້ - ບໍ່ມີໃບອະນຸຍາດ Diffblue, ບໍ່ມີຄ່າໃຊ້ຈ່າຍ $50 / dev.
ຜົນອອກມາທີ່ຖືກຕ້ອງຕາມກອບ
ກົດ​ Ctrl+Enter ເພື່ອ​ສົ່ງ​ຂໍ້ຄວາມ 0 / 12,000

ຖອດ​ໄຟ​ລ໌​ແຫຼ່ງ (ເຖິງ 500KB) — ພວກເຮົາ​ຈະ​ບິດ​ມັນ​ເຂົ້າ​ໄປ​ໃນ​ແຖບ​ໂປຣແກຣມ.

ຊື້​ໂຕກັ່ນ
ປ້າຍ​ລະຫັດ​ເພື່ອ​ທົດສອບ
ການທົດສອບ

        
ປະຕິບັດ​ຄຳ​ສັ່ງ

        
ບັນທຶກ​ການ​ປົກ​ຄຸມ
ຂັ້ນຕອນ​ຕໍ່ໄປ
ຕົວເລືອກ​ລະດັບ​ສູງ
ຜົນ
ບັດ​ທອງ​ເຫຼືອ​ບໍ່​ພຽງພໍ​ແລ້ວ ເອົາ​ໂຕກັ່ນ​ເພີ່ມ​ຕື່ມ
ຕ້ອງການຜົນໄດ້ຮັບທີ່ດີກວ່າ? ແບບ​ພິເສດ (GPT-5, Claude, Gemini) ສົ່ງຄຸນນະພາບສູງ. ເບິ່ງ​ແຜນ

❤️ ຮັກ Free.ai? ເວົ້າກັບເພື່ອນຂອງທ່ານ!

ລົງທະບຽນ ເພື່ອໄດ້ຮັບລິ້ງແນະນໍາແລະຫາເງິນ 25,000 ບັດຕໍ່ເພື່ອນ.

ຕ້ອງການ​ເພີ່ມ​ເຕີມ​ບໍ? ລົງທະບຽນສໍາລັບການຟຣີ 30K ຕົວແທນ / ວັນ + 10K ເງິນຝາກ
ລົງທະບຽນຟຣີ

ກຳລັງ​ປະມວນຜົນ​ຄໍາຮ້ອງຂໍ​ຂອງທ່ານ...

ສ້າງການທົດສອບແລະຊຸດທົດສອບດ້ວຍ AI ຟຣີ. ປົກຄຸມໂປຣແກຣມເຕັມໂດຍອັດຕະໂນມັດ.

ວິທີການ​ໃຊ້ ຕົວ​ສ້າງ​ການ​ທົດສອບ

1
បញ្ចូល​ຂໍ້ມູນ​ເຂົ້າ​ມາ​ຂອງ​ທ່ານ

ພິມຂໍ້ຄວາມ, ສົ່ງ​ໄຟລ໌​ຂຶ້ນ​ໄປ, ຫຼື ອະທິບາຍ​ສິ່ງທີ່​ທ່ານ​ຕ້ອງການ. ບໍ່ມີ​ບັນຊີ​ທີ່​ຕ້ອງການ.

2
ສ້າງ​

AI ຂອງພວກເຮົາ ຈັດການຄໍາຮ້ອງຂໍຂອງທ່ານໃນສອງສາມວິນາທີ ໂດຍໃຊ້ແບບຟອມ Open-Source ທີ່ດີທີ່ສຸດ.

3
ດາວໂຫລດ ແລະ ແບ່ງປັນ

ດາວໂຫລດ, ຖ່າຍທອດ, ຫຼື ແບ່ງປັນຜົນງານຂອງທ່ານ. ໂດຍບໍ່ເສຍຄ່າ ສຳ ລັບໃຊ້ສ່ວນຕົວ ແລະ ການຄ້າ.

ប្រើ​ເຄື່ອງມື​ນີ້​ຜ່ານ API

ເຄື່ອງມືນີ້ອັດຕະໂນມັດຈາກໂປຣແກຣມຂອງທ່ານເອງ. OpenAI-ເຂົ້າກັນໄດ້ REST endpoint, Bearer-token auth, ບໍ່ຈໍາເປັນຕ້ອງມີ SDK ເພີ່ມເຕີມ. ຄ່າໃຊ້ຈ່າຍຂອງ token ກົງກັບເວບໄຊທ໌.

curl -X POST https://api.free.ai/v1/chat/ \
  -H "Authorization: Bearer sk-free-..." \
  -H "Content-Type: application/json" \
  -d '{"model": "qwen-coder", "messages": [{"role": "user", "content": "Write a Python function that reverses a string."}]}'

ຕົວ​ສ້າງ​ການ​ທົດສອບ — FAQ

ຕິດ​ຕັ້ງ​ຕົວ​ເລືອກ, ຊັ້ນ, ຫຼື ໄຟ​ລ໌​ທັງ​ຫມົດ ແລະ ​ໄດ້​ຮັບ​ຊຸດ​ການ​ທົດສອບ​ທີ່​ສົມບູນ​ຄືນ​ມາ - ກໍລະນີ​ທາງ​ທີ່​ດີ, ກໍລະນີ​ດ້ານ​ລຸ່ມ, ກໍລະນີ​ຂໍ້​ຜິດພາດ, ແລະ (ເປັນ​ທາງເລືອກ) ການ​ທົດສອບ​ທີ່​ອີງ​ໃສ່​ຄຸນ​ສົມບັດ. ເລືອກ​ກອບ​ການ​ທົດສອບ​ຢ່າງ​ຊັດເຈນ (pytest / unittest / Jest / Mocha / Vitest / JUnit / Go test / RSpec / PHPUnit / XCTest / ອື່ນໆ) ເພື່ອ​ຜົນ​ອອກ​ມາ​ຈະ​ເໝາະສົມ​ກັບ​ຂໍ້​ຕົກລົງ​ຂອງ​ໂຄງການ​ຂອງທ່ານ.

Diffblue Cover ແມ່ນ Java-only ແລະເລີ່ມຕົ້ນທີ່ $50/dev/month ຫຼັງຈາກທີ່ຊັ້ນຟຣີໄດ້ກີດຂວາງຢູ່ໂຄງການນ້ອຍໆ. Codium AI (ປັດຈຸບັນ Qodo) ແມ່ນຟຣີ ສຳ ລັບບຸກຄົນແຕ່ throttles ການໃຊ້ງານຫນັກແລະຮູບແບບການທົດສອບຂອງໜ່ວຍງານແມ່ນຖືກປັບປຸງໃຫ້ດີຂື້ນ ສຳ ລັບ patch IDE-inline, ບໍ່ແມ່ນຊຸດໄຟລ໌ທັງ ໝົດ. Tabnine ຈັດການທົດສອບການເກີດ ໃໝ່ ເຂົ້າໃນແຜນ Pro $12 / mo. Free.ai ແມ່ນ 100% ຟຣີພາຍໃຕ້ສະໂມສອນ Token ປະຈຳວັນ, ສະຫນັບສະຫນູນ9ກອບໃນທົ່ວພາສາໃຫຍ່ທັງ ໝົດ, ແລະຊ່ວຍໃຫ້ທ່ານສາມາດເລືອກເປົ້າຫມາຍການປົກຄຸມຢ່າງຈະແຈ້ງ (ມີຄວາມສຸກ / edge / error / property-based).

Python: pytest ສຳ ລັບໂຄງການ ໃໝ່ (ທັນສະໄໝ, ອຸປະກອນ, ຕົວກໍານົດການ), unittest ສຳ ລັບຂໍ້ຈໍາກັດ stdlib- only. JavaScript: Vitest (ໄວ Vite- native) ຫຼື Jest (ນິຍົມທີ່ສຸດ). TypeScript: Vitest ຫຼື Jest ກັບ ts- jest. Java: JUnit 5. Go: ລວມເອົາຄອບ​ຄຸມ​ທົດສອບ. Ruby: RSpec. PHP: PHPUnit. Swift: XCTest. ຕົວເລືອກບັງຄັບໃຫ້ແບບ ຈຳ ລອງໃຊ້ຄຳເວົ້າ / ພາສາອຸປະກອນທີ່ຖືກຕ້ອງ ສຳ ລັບກອບທີ່ເລືອກ.

ແທນທີ່ຈະຢືນຢັນກ່ຽວກັບ inputs ເລືອກດ້ວຍມື, ແບບຈໍາລອງຂຽນ Hypothesis (Python), fast-check (JS / TS), ຫຼື junit-quickcheck (Java) ການທົດສອບທີ່ຜະລິດຫຼາຍຮ້ອຍຂອງ inputs ຊົ່ວຄາວແລະກວດສອບຊັບສິນຖືສໍາລັບພວກເຂົາທັງຫມົດ. ຈັບບົກຜ່ອງການທົດສອບທີ່ຂຽນດ້ວຍມື miss - off-by-one, integer overflow, ກໍລະນີດ້ານລຸ່ມເກັບກໍາຫວ່າງ. ນໍາໃຊ້ໃນເວລາທີ່ຄຸນສົມບັດພາຍໃຕ້ການທົດສອບມີ invariant ຢ່າງຈະແຈ້ງ (ຈັດລຽງ, ການວິເຄາະ roundtrip, ແລະອື່ນໆ).

ບໍ່ມີ — Free.ai ສ້າງລະຫັດທົດສອບ; ທ່ານປະຕິບັດມັນພາຍໃນ. ເປີດ / coder / ເພື່ອປ່ອຍທັງສອງເອກະສານເຂົ້າໄປໃນ sandbox ຂອງຕົວທ່ອງເວັບຂອງພວກເຮົາແລະປະຕິບັດ, ຫຼື ປ້າຍເຂົ້າໄປໃນ repo ພາຍໃນຂອງທ່ານແລະປະຕິບັດ pytest / npm test / go test ຕາມປົກກະຕິ. ຜົນໄດ້ຮັບປະກອບມີຄໍາສັ່ງ CLI ຢ່າງແທ້ຈິງ ສຳ ລັບກອບທີ່ເລືອກ.

ແບບຈໍາລອງແມ່ນບອກໃຫ້ສ້າງຢ່າງໜ້ອຍ 1 happy-path, 2-3 ກໍລະນີດ້ານ, ແລະ (ຖ້າຂໍ້ຜິດພາດແມ່ນກວດເບິ່ງ) 1-2 ການທົດສອບເສັ້ນທາງຂໍ້ຜິດພາດຕໍ່ຟັງຊັນສາທາລະນະ. ສໍາລັບການປົກຄຸມຢ່າງເຂັ້ມງວດທາງຄະນິດສາດໃຊ້ເຄື່ອງມືປົກຄຸມ (coverage.py, c8, jacoco) ຫຼັງຈາກແລ່ນ — Free.ai ເປົ້າຫມາຍການປົກຄຸມພຶດຕິກໍາ, ບໍ່ແມ່ນການປົກຄຸມເສັ້ນ.

ການທົດສອບທີ່ຜະລິດໂດຍ AI ແມ່ນຈຸດເລີ່ມຕົ້ນ - ພວກເຂົາປົກຄຸມກໍລະນີທີ່ຊັດເຈນໄວ (ສຸກ + ດ້ານມາດຕະຖານ) ສະນັ້ນທ່ານສາມາດສຸມໃສ່ invariants ທຸລະກິດທີ່ສັບສົນ. ອ່ານການທົດສອບແຕ່ລະຄັ້ງກ່ອນທີ່ຈະລົງນາມ; ແບບ ຈຳ ລອງບາງຄັ້ງກໍ່ຢືນຢັນກ່ຽວກັບຄ່າຄາດຫວັງທີ່ຜິດພາດເມື່ອຊື່ຂອງຟັງຊັນແມ່ນສັບສົນ.

ແບບຢ່າງ​ນີ້​ຈະ​ເນັ້ນ​ໃສ່​ການ​ທົດສອບ​ຜ່ານ API ສາທາລະນະ. ຖ້າ​ທ່ານ​ຕ້ອງການ​ການ​ປົກ​ປ້ອງ​ແບບ​ວິທີ​ສ່ວນ​ຕົວ​ຢ່າງ​ຊັດເຈນ, ກ່າວ​ເຖິງ​ມັນ​ໃນ​ການ​ແຈ້ງ​ເຕືອນ - ແບບ​ຢ່າງ​ຈະ​ໃຊ້​ກົນໄກ​ຂອງ​ພາສາ (ການ​ປ່ຽນ​ຊື່​ຂອງ Python, ການ​ເຂົ້າ​ເຖິງ​ແບບ​ດັ້ງ​ເດີມ JS, ການ​ສະທ້ອນ​ຂອງ Java) ແຕ່​ຈະ​ແຈ້ງ​ເຕືອນ​ທ່ານ​ວ່າ​ມັນ​ເປັນ​ກິ່ນ​ຂອງ​ໂປຣ​ແກຣມ.

ຍິນດີ — ເມື່ອແຫຼ່ງທີ່ມາທີ່ຢູ່ໃນການທົດສອບນໍາເຂົ້າລູກຄ້າ DB, HTTP ລູກຄ້າ, ໄຟລ໌ I / O, ແລະອື່ນໆ ແບບ ຈຳ ລອງໃຊ້ framework's mocking primitive (pytest monkeypatch / unittest.mock, Jest jest.mock, Mockito for Java) ແລະສະຫນອງການ fakes ຢ່າງຫນ້ອຍ. ສໍາລັບ mocks ທີ່ສັບສົນ (10-method DB ໄລຍະເວລາ) ທ່ານອາດຈະງ່າຍດາຍໂດຍມືຫຼັງຈາກນັ້ນ.

ເຖິງ 12,000 ຕົວອັກສອນ (~ 180 ສາຍ) ໃນເສັ້ນທາງທີ່ເປັນເຈົ້າພາບເອງ. ຂໍ້ຄວາມຍາວ Claude / GPT ຈັດການກັບການທົດສອບໄຟລ໌ເຕັມ (ຕົວອັກສອນ 200K +) - ປ່ຽນເມື່ອສ້າງການທົດສອບ ສຳ ລັບໂມດູນເຕັມ.

ໂຄດຖືກສົ່ງໄປຫາແບບ, ຖືກປະມວນຜົນແລະຖືກຖິ້ມ. ຕົວໂຫຼດຕົວເອງ Qwen3Coder ແລ່ນຢູ່ໃນ GPUs ຂອງ Free.ai ເອງ - ແຫຼ່ງຂອງທ່ານບໍ່ເຄີຍອອກຈາກພື້ນຖານໂຄງລ່າງຂອງພວກເຮົາ. ແບບນອກຂອງ Premium (Claude / GPT-5) ເສັ້ນທາງຜ່ານຜູ້ສະ ໜອງ ຂອງພວກເຂົາພາຍໃຕ້ເງື່ອນໄຂການຈັດການຂໍ້ມູນຂອງພວກເຂົາ.

ຍິນດີ — POST to /v1/chat/ with the test system prompt (framework + coverage targets) and the source as the user message. ມີຄວາມ​ຈຳ​ເປັນ​ສຳລັບ​ຂັ້ນຕອນ CI ທີ່​ສ້າງ​ການ​ທົດສອບ​ໃຫ້​ກັບ​ໄຟ​ລ໌​ໃໝ່​ໂດຍ​ອັດຕະໂນມັດ. ເບິ່ງ /api/ ສຳ​ລັບ​ snippets.

ລົງທະບຽນຟຣີສໍາລັບ 30,000 ຕົວແທນ

ສ້າງ​ບັນຊີ​ຟຣີ

ບໍ່ມີ​ບັດ​ເຄຣດິດ​ທີ່​ຕ້ອງການ

ທ່ານຈະໃຫ້ຄະແນນເຄື່ອງມືນີ້ແນວໃດ?

5.0/5 from 1 rating

ຮັກ Free.ai? ເວົ້າກັບເພື່ອນຂອງທ່ານ!